JP Morgan Chase's FDEV Position: Q2 2026 in Review
JP Morgan Chase increased its Fidelity International Multifactor ETF (FDEV) stake by 5.3% in Q2 2026, buying an estimated $175K and bringing the position to 95,511 shares worth $3.38M. The position accounts for ﹤0.01% of the portfolio, ranked #3788.
JP Morgan Chase first reported a position in FDEV in Q4 2019 and has held it in 8 quarters since. 46 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old FDEV as of Q2 2026.
